Output 571353121d64c4f53b44493a2800f2525b4668ee8158b25427f862efcaf33333:2

value
139100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f3295100b3dcf117e2709744c8a975afdee4c8 OP_EQUAL
address
37FHmCkAqNiXDVafJDL8mxS88tP8t8dy9X
transaction
571353121d64c4f53b44493a2800f2525b4668ee8158b25427f862efcaf33333
confirmations
155171
spent
true